Hi guys, any info on what's going on here? Just got a new clutch fitted. I know that the heat sensor on the CAT got damaged during the refit & the warning light is on, That's understandable. The main issue is that on idle, the CEL shows up! If I even just touch the throttle slightly, it goes out. have checked all fluids as I thought it may be low on oil pressure or similar, but all seems OK. Any ideas or is it a take to the garage job?

Hi mate, your best bet is to plug in the two black plugs under the steering wheel,looking up from the pedals.

Turn on ur ignition and the CEL light should do a series of flashes,(long ones,short ones)if you get a list of the fault codes these flashes will tell you the stored fault.
